Opportunity snapshot. This Grants.gov announcement - Fiscal Year (FY) 2023 Volunteer Generation Fund - is cataloged under number AC-03-18-23 and tied to CFDA assistance listing 94.021, posted by AmeriCorps. Grants.gov currently shows the opportunity as closed, first posted on March 17, 2023. The funding category is Discretionary, delivered as a grant.

Award economics. The award range on file is $100,000 -- $1,000,000. The agency has projected $8.6 million in total estimated funding for this announcement. Cost sharing or matching funds are required, meaning applicants must contribute a portion of the project budget from non-federal sources, factor this into your financial plan before drafting the proposal. Description

The Volunteer Generation Fund (VGF) supports organizations to boost the impact of volunteers on critical community needs and rebuild the volunteer infrastructure after the covid pandemic. VGF focuses on investments in volunteer management practices that strengthen nonprofit organizations and other entity's ability to increase recruitment and retention of volunteers to meet critical community needs through service.
